 Tip 1)  Breathe  in a regulated way

When you are anxious your breathing often becomes out of rhythm. You either start breathing really fast and harder or you stop breathing entirely for many seconds. Both these actions may appear natural and involuntary however they are habits you can control . In fact breathing in a slow regular state calms down your mind and helps you think logically. When you are in a calmer state you automatically become more confident because your mind isn’t clouded by negative emotions.

So the next time you are anxious and catch yourself breathing irregularly, stop! Slowly take deep long breaths where both the inhalation and exhalation process lasts at least a few seconds each.  There are a variety of resources available on the internet than can teach you the right breathing exercises to calm you down and become more confident.  Tip 4) Exercise Regularly

Exercise helps in two ways. One, it makes you look better. When you look better, you get a positive self image. When people see you look good or have lost weight, they pay compliments to you or pay more attention to you thereby raising your confidence even more.

Secondly, exercise has been shown to boost mood elevating endorphins which make you feel better. In fact depressed people are regularly advised by medical practitioners to workout because exercise elevates their mood, makes them feel happy and more confident.

But do remember that exercise is a habit, so once won’t be enough. You have to make it a part of your life forever if you want to see sustained changes in your body and consequently improve your overall confidence levels.

 


Tip 5) Face your fears

If you want to learn how to be confident in life you will have to step outside your comfort zone and face your fears. If you avoid what you fear, a false message gets sent to your brain that the thing you are avoiding is harmful or will get you into a lot of trouble. So when you avoid it for a bit, you feel safe, but the moment it comes into the picture again, your brain sends you an even bigger fear message thus wrecking your confidence in the ability to deal with it.

You have two options at that time, either you face it and gradually let the fear subside. Or avoid it yet again and then have the fear rise even more thus continuing a vicious cycle until which you become extremely scared of facing it. This vicious cycle avoiding behaviour plays a big role in the development of phobias. Avoidance makes you feel safe temporarily but is a hugely destructive behaviour in the long run. So no matter how cliche it sounds,  one of the most effective ways to learn how to be confident in life is to face what ever you fear. You then stay with it as long as possible and as often as possible until the fear gradually subsides on its own and your brain reprograms itself.

Tip 7) Visualize the Best outcome

Visualization techniques are used often as an aid by some of the most successful people in the world like Elite Olympic Level Athletes and Astronauts flying on Space Missions.

Visualization basically means you sit down with your eyes closed and imagine, step by step, the things you would do or the exact process that would lead to your desired perfect outcome. An Olympic Level Swimmer would thus imagine the perfect way in which he or she would dive into the water, the perfect streamlined way in which they would swim, with the least amount of resistance, that would put them ahead of their competitors and would lead them to win the event.

While visualization is not a substitute for actual hard work or practice that would help you develop the skill to achieve your desired goal, when you visualize you make yourself believe with absolute certainty that winning is possible for you. And when you are filled with the belief that you will, winning becomes much more easier as long as it has been complimented with the right real life hard work.  Tip 8) Prepare Really Hard

Working really hard on preparation is the most important way to build self confidence. When was the last time you felt confident about doing anything if you had not prepared for it at all? Unless you are supremely talented or delusional, you would not feel confident at all. The more you prepare with strict self discipline, the more confident you become.

Let’s go back to the Olympic swimmer analogy, no matter how many visualization exercises you do, will you acquire the actual skill to beat your competition without getting into the water every single day and preparing? Absolutely not.  And even if you did get the delusional self confidence, it would be shattered the day you got into the pool in an actual competition.

Muhammad Ali, the great boxing champion had a habit of proclaiming ” I am the Greatest!” almost all the time as a way to build up his self confidence. The greatest he was indeed, at least in boxing, however, thousands of other boxers tried telling themselves the same, without much success. This is true even for the talented ones. Why did it work for Muhammad Ali, when it did not work for others?

It worked for Ali because he backed up his talent and confidence with supreme hard work and preparation. Training for hours every single day, going through the most rigorous of preparations he built himself into an indomitable force.  He trained so hard that he became a force that could not be beaten. Apply the same discipline to your goal as Ali did to his,  confidence and skill will both come automatically.
